Mixing scratchy funk, jagged guitar and the freewheeling spirit of jazz, Manchester’s A Certain Ratio did as much as anyone to invent post-punk. Over 45 years later, they remain very much a going concern. Indeed, ACR are flourishing, as proved by the trio’s back-to-basics 13th album – largely recorded over a 12-hour session with producer Dan Carey. Standouts include the angular pop of God Knows and the reflective yet funky We All Need, but more important is the sense of ACR referencing the past while still moving forwards.
